No employee business expenses, including firearms are deductible for a federal tax return. A law enforcement officer can deduct the costs of materials, text books, supplies, tuition fees, registration fees and correspondence course fees if he must take continuing education courses as part of his job. The deduction of firearms is very problematic and is one of the most controversial areas in litigation with the franchise tax board.

The state and local tax deduction, known as the salt deduction, lets you deduct the value of your state and local property tax payments, plus either your income or sales taxes. Public safety budgets across the us are largely drawn from state and local property sales and income taxes.
